If you are somewhat a student of military history like I am, you are well aware of a couple of enemy propagandists named Tokyo Rose and Axis Sally. These ladies had a regular radio show that tried to demoralize Allied troops. They would talk about home and whether or not the soldier’s wives were being faithful, lies that the Axis was defeating them so just surrender and other topics hoping the troops would desert or be so depressed they would not be at their peak fighting force. Most of the troops found them to be a source of humor and entertainment and they were the ones who gave these ladies their radio moniker. Propaganda can work and is still greatly used in many areas around the world either to start a war or as part of a war effort and even political races.

If our war were with flesh and blood, we would use earthly weapons of warfare. It is not and we must keep our eyes focused on the true enemy. Like an earthly warrior, we must know our enemies capabilities, tactics and weaknesses. From the beginning, the enemy has used lying propaganda tactics that started the war on earth he had already started in Heaven with his treason and sin.

Genesis 3:1  Now the serpent was more subtil than any beast of the field which the LORD God had made. And he said unto the woman, Yea, hath God said, Ye shall not eat of every tree of the garden? 

Note the serpent was more cunning than the other beasts, which is why the enemy used it. We still call an evil charmer a snake in the grass. Just as Rose and Sally used what the soldiers could see in an effort to deceive them and question their leadership, the enemy of our souls started talking with Eve seeking to cause doubt. He was looking for her weakness and when he saw that she liked looking at forbidden fruit and then added to what God said about it he worked on that. Whereas our ladies in WWII sought to bring great fear of death the serpent sought to remove the fear of death and thus setting the trap. It looked good, the allure of being like God, wondering what it tasted like and nothing happened when she touched it led to that bite which sprung the trap creating the despair of mankind when Adam willfully followed her lead. Satan’s basic tactics have not changed.

2 Corinthians 2:11  Lest Satan should get an advantage of us: for we are not ignorant of his devices. 

In the passage, Paul is telling the Church to forgive and receive the repentant man that was involved in having sex with his step-mother; not his father’s widow. That was such a heinous sin that not even the pagans condoned it. You know it is really bad when even hedonistic pagans who routinely held orgies in their temples wouldn’t do it. She is not mentioned so she may not have been a Christian as Paul only rebuked him.

He was to be received unless he be swallowed up by overmuch sorrow. The Church represents Christ and they were to affirm their love to him. Because of the sin, I am sure some had a hard time forgiving him in their flesh even though they knew they should. Sadly, many people who have sinned are not in church and overcome by the guilt and shame of their sin because Christians did not reach out to them. They repented and came to church but the members treated them like a leper so they left and are tormented thinking God has also rejected them. They may even be angry at God because of the actions of people claiming to be His.
